Creamy Spinach Tortellini with Blackened Shrimp 🦐🧄
Creamy, cheesy pasta meets spicy, seared shrimp—pure indulgence!
📝 Ingredients:
1 lb shrimp, peeled & deveined
9 oz cheese tortellini (fresh or refrigerated)
1 tbsp olive oil
2 tsp Cajun or blackened seasoning
2 cups fresh spinach, chopped
1 tbsp butter
3 cloves garlic, minced
1 cup heavy cream
½ cup grated Parmesan cheese
Salt & black pepper, to taste
🍽️ Directions:
1️⃣ Cook the Tortellini:
Boil tortellini according to package directions. Drain and set aside.
2️⃣ Blacken the Shrimp:
Toss shrimp in Cajun or blackened seasoning. Heat olive oil in a skillet over medium-high and sear shrimp 2–3 minutes per side until golden. Remove and set aside.
3️⃣ Make the Cream Sauce:
In the same skillet, melt butter. Sauté garlic for 1 minute, then add cream and bring to a gentle simmer.
4️⃣ Add Spinach & Cheese:
Stir in spinach and cook until wilted. Add Parmesan, stir until smooth, then season with salt and pepper.
5️⃣ Toss Pasta & Finish:
Add cooked tortellini and toss to coat in the sauce. Top with blackened shrimp and serve hot.
Prep Time: 10 minutes | Cook Time: 20 minutes | Total Time: 30 minutes
Calories: ~620 per serving | Protein: ~35g per serving
